Event description
Employee pouring molten metal burns eye when splashed
Investigation abstract
At 1:00 p.m. on December 27, 2021, an employee was pouring molten aluminum when the metal splashed and struck the area around his eye socket. The employee sought medical treatment at a local hospital and was transferred via ambulance and admitted to a medical center burn unit for treatment of 2nd degree burns. The employee was released from the hospital the next day.
